Supreme Yearbooks hardcover yearbooks use a binding process that is both sewn and glued. This binding process meets the requirements of the Library of Congress archival approved binding process. Books using this process are designed to still retain their pages and function for 100 years or more.
Supreme Yearbooks covers use a heavy printed casing over a chipboard base. We also laminate the covers for an even stronger exterior, and to reduce the impacts of moisture and spills from damaging the cover of your yearbook.
For very large yearbooks, we also have the ability to use a smyth binding process. This process offers the durability of a hardcover yearbook, but also allows the book to have a flatter profile when open.

Hardcover Yearbook Specifications:
Covers are printed on 80 lb. gloss text weight paper in process color
Covers are gloss laminated for strength and stretched around a chipboard casing with safety paper
Hardcover yearbooks are side sewn, glued and case bound for maximum durability
Text pages are also printed on 80 lb. gloss text in process color
Hardcover yearbooks are typically 8.5"W x 11"H page size
Larger quantity books (typically 500+) can be printed on with an offset press rather than digital. Page size for these books can be up to 9" x 12".
